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with the development team, client, and their users to understand technical constraints, business goals, and user needs
  • Translate product ideas into product features with clear requirements and validate them with stakeholders, users, and the development team
  • Suggest, clearly explain, and own the Sprint Goal
  • Manage the product backlog and prioritize the product backlog items
  • Develop user stories, epics, and initiatives
  • Help the team stay focused on creating high-value increments
  • Identify and manage dependencies and development risks
  • Understand relevant use cases and business-critical processes
  • Lead the Sprint Planning, Sprint Review, and Backlog Refinements
  • Participate in Agile ceremonies
  • Create product documentation
